高性价比
国外便宜VPS服务器推荐

构建高可用性和可扩大性的服务器网络架构

随着互联网的快速发展,服务器网络架构的可用性和可扩展性变得越来越重要。一旦服务器网络出现故障,就会导致网站无法访问,从而造成严重的经济损失。构建高可用性和可扩展性的服务器网络架构已成为现代企业的必要条件。本文将从多个方面对构建高可用性和可扩展性的服务器网络架构进行详细阐述。

硬件架构的优化

在构建高可用性和可扩展性的服务器网络架构时,硬件架构的优化是非常重要的。服务器的选型要根据业务需求进行选择,确保服务器的性能和稳定性。服务器的冗余设计也是非常重要的,例如采用双电源、双网卡、双硬盘等冗余设计,以保证服务器的高可用性。服务器的负载均衡也是非常重要的,可以采用硬件负载均衡器来实现,以确保服务器的可扩展性。

网络架构的优化

网络架构的优化也是构建高可用性和可扩展性的服务器网络架构的重要方面。采用多层次的网络架构,例如三层或四层网络架构,可以提高网络的可用性和可扩展性。采用冗余的网络设备,例如交换机、路由器等,可以保证网络的高可用性。网络的负载均衡也是非常重要的,可以采用软件负载均衡器来实现,以确保网络的可扩展性。

数据备份和恢复

数据备份和恢复也是构建高可用性和可扩展性的服务器网络架构的重要方面。需要制定完善的数据备份计划,包括备份的频率、备份的位置、备份的方式等。需要测试备份和恢复的流程,以确保备份和恢复的可靠性。还需要定期进行数据恢复测试,以确保数据的完整性和可用性。

应用程序的优化

应用程序的优化也是构建高可用性和可扩展性的服务器网络架构的重要方面。需要对应用程序进行性能测试和压力测试,以确定应用程序的瓶颈和性能瓶颈。需要对应用程序进行优化,例如缓存优化、数据库优化、代码优化等,以提高应用程序的性能和可扩展性。还需要对应用程序进行监控和诊断,及时发现和解决问题,以确保应用程序的稳定性和可用性。

安全性的优化

安全性的优化也是构建高可用性和可扩展性的服务器网络架构的重要方面。需要制定完善的安全策略,包括网络安全、系统安全、应用程序安全等。需要对服务器进行定期的安全检查和漏洞扫描,及时发现和解决安全问题。还需要对服务器进行加固和防护,例如安装防火墙、加密通信等,以确保服务器的安全性和可用性。

构建高可用性和可扩展性的服务器网络架构是现代企业必须面对的挑战。通过优化硬件架构、网络架构、数据备份和恢复、应用程序和安全性,可以提高服务器网络的可用性和可扩展性,从而保证企业的业务连续性和稳定性。

未经允许不得转载:一万网络 » 构建高可用性和可扩大性的服务器网络架构